Why one drive side has less power than the other?

I actually have a Craftsman Z6900 zero turn mower, but that wasn't an option to select.

My problem is that the drive on the left side is not producing as much power as the right side. On level ground it operates fine, but as soon as I have to go up a hill I have to fully engage the left side (and I hear a groaning sound, like power steering in a car when the fluid level is low) but the right side can stay just partially engaged and provides plenty of power. I have read that my mower has a hydrostatic transmission, but I have no idea if this one is serviceable or how to do that if it is. Any ideas? Mahalo.

@phillfam10 looks like your mower uses a Hydro-Gear 2200 Integrated Hydrostatic Transaxle EZT Series for the drive. Those drives are a bit tough to work on etc. I would check the oil,and purge the unit. After that you may need to check the bypass and see if that is within specs. For all off that refer to the SM Hydro Gear 310 2200 EZT
